Before even trying to put this into the binomial form, we must figure out the coefficients. If we go by the Pascal's Triangles way we should end up with:
1
1 1
1 2 1
1 3 3 1
Going by the last level (which is the third level) we get 3C0:1, 3C1:3, 3C2:3, 3C3:1.
Now with the equation: (a+b)^3 = 3C0a^3 + 3C1a^2 b + 3C2a b^2 + 3C3b^3 we just plug in all the values and simplify
